POST
/
api
/
v1
/
transfers
/
address
curl --request POST \
  --url https://api.international.coinbase.com/api/v1/transfers/address \
  --header 'CB-ACCESS-KEY: <api-key>' \
  --header 'CB-ACCESS-PASSPHRASE: <api-key>' \
  --header 'CB-ACCESS-SIGN: <api-key>' \
  --header 'CB-ACCESS-TIMESTAMP: <api-key>' \
  --header 'Content-Type: application/json' \
  --data '{
  "portfolio": "<string>",
  "asset": "<string>",
  "network_arn_id": "networks/ethereum-mainnet/assets/313ef8a9-ae5a-5f2f-8a56-572c0e2a4d5a"
}'
{
  "address": "1KpPmua1jzSxMMZ5iPGizyetpCPkZHNKTd",
  "network_arn_id": "networks/ethereum-mainnet/assets/313ef8a9-ae5a-5f2f-8a56-572c0e2a4d5a",
  "destination_tag": "<string>"
}
TransfersService transfersService = IntxServiceFactory.createTransfersService(client);
CreateCryptoAddressRequest request = new CreateCryptoAddressRequest.Builder()
    .portfolio("portfolio_id")
    .asset("ETH")
    .build();
CreateCryptoAddressResponse response = addressesService.createCryptoAddress(request);

For more information, please visit the INTX Java SDK.

Authorizations

CB-ACCESS-KEY
string
header
required

The Client ID that owns the API Key for the request

CB-ACCESS-PASSPHRASE
string
header
required

The pass phrase affiliated with the API Key

CB-ACCESS-SIGN
string
header
required

A HMAC SHA-256 signature using the API Key secret on the string TIMESTAMP, METHOD, REQUEST_PATH, BODY

CB-ACCESS-TIMESTAMP
string
header
required

The timestamp of when the request is being made

Body

application/json

Response

200
application/json

Address created

The response is of type object.